    How to install Power Curve in FCPX Pro?
    • In the Finder hold the Option key and from the Go menu select Library.
    • Then go to Application Support/ProApps. The go to ProApps > Effects Presets.
    • You have to place all the .effectsPreset files here.
    • Restart Final Cut Pro, you can see all your Power Curves Presets in effects panel ((Most probably in the 360 category)"
